Hi Topman
Are you referring to emulsion paint ? If you are, then the easiest way is to let it dry completely over a few days and then just scrape it out in lumps !! (Presume you are using plastic tray). If you've been using gloss or u/coat, then wait a lot longer before you try and scrape. Always worked for me over the last 20 or so years.

Put a good quality plastic bag over your paintray before you fill it. After use throw the plastic bag away. This is also ideal if you want to paint with more than one colour with the same tray.
